In Re; DRAIN COMMISSIONER—ESTABLISHMENT OF A DAM REPLACEMENT
REVOLVING FUND
To the Oakland County Board of Commissioners
Mr. Chairperson, Ladies, and Gentlemen:
WHEREAS the Inland Lake Level Act, Act No. 146 of the Public Acts
of 1961, as amended, provides in Section 5 that the Board of Commissioners
shall determine the method of financing the initial costs of a lake level project;
and
WHEREAS the Oakland County Board of Commissioners adopted Miscellaneous
Resolution #81275 on August 6, 1981, which authorized an advance from the
general funds of the County of Oakland in the amount of $300,000 in order
to reduce the total cost of the repairs of the Pontiac Lake Dam and to reduce
the severity of the financial impact of the special assessments that were
to be levied against the parcels of land benefited by the dam reconstruction;
and
WHEREAS $100,000 of the advance for the Pontiac Lake Dam has been
repaid to the general funds of Oakland County with $200,000 still to be repaid;
and
WHEREAS there are many dams located on lakes in Oakland County
which through age and deterioration require repair, reconstruction, or replacement
due to the age and deterioration over time of these existing dams and other
lake level control structures; and
WHEREAS the repair, reconstruction, or replacement of dams or other
lake level control structures on lakes in Oakland County when such structures
require replacement due to age or deterioration over a period of time will
protect the public health, safety, and welfare and conserve the natural resources
of the County of Oakland; and
WHEREAS the establishment of a dam replacement revolving fund to
pay for the initial costs of the repair, reconstruction, or replacement of
dams with any advance from the revolving fund to be repaid from assessments
against the property owners or municipalities, in a special assessment district,
will provide a method of financing where the Board of Commissioners determines
that a dam should be repaired, reconstructed, or replaced under the provisions
of the Inland Lake Level Act for the protection of the public health, safety,
and welfare and the conservation of the natural resources of the County
of Oakland; and
WHEREAS the Oakland County Board of Commissioners desires to establish
a darn replacement revolving fund in the amount of $700,000 from which
advances may be authorized only by resolution of the Board of Commissioners
for projects established pursuant to the provisions of Act 146 of the Public
Acts of 1961.
NOW TH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the Oakland County Board of
Commissioners establishes a dam replacement revolving fund to pay for the
initial costs of repair, reconstruction, or replacement of dams when authorized
by resolution of the Board of Commissioners for proceedings under the Inland
Lake Level Act, with all advances from the revolving fund to be repaid
by special assessment against the property owners or municipalities in the
assessment district established pursuant to the statute.
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Oakland County Board of Commissioners
directs the transfer of the sum of $500,000 to the dam replacement revolving
fund to provide a method of financing for the initial costs for the repair,
reconstruction, or replacement of dams or other lake level control structures
in Oakland County.
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Oakland County Board of Commissioners
directs that the repayment of the remaining balance of $200,000 from the
Pontiac Lake Dam advance be repaid to the Dam Replacement Revolving Fund
rather than to the General Fund.

#86131 May 22, 1986
Moved by Hobart supported by Fortino the resolution (with
Fiscal Note attached) be adopted.
Moved by Webb supported by Olsen the resolution be amended by
adding: "B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that repayment of all project costs to
the revolving fund be made with interest charged at the prime rate
prevailing at the commencement of the project."
Moved by Perinoff supported by Pernick the amendment be amended
by setting the interest rate at 6%.
Discussion followed.
Vote on Mr. Perinoff's amendment to the amendment:
AYES: Wilcox, Aaron, Doyon, Gosling, Hassberger, Lanni, Olsen,
Perinoff, Pernick. (9)
NAYS: Rewold, Rowland, Skarritt, Webb, Caddell, Calandro,
Fortino, Hobart, R. Kuhn, S. Kuhn, Law, McConnell, McDonald, McPherson,
Moffitt, Nelson, Page, Price. (18)
A sufficient majority not having voted therefor, the amendment
to the amendment failed.
Vote on Mrs. Webb's amendment:
AYES: Webb, Aaron, Doyon, Gosling, Hassberger, Lanni, Moffitt,
Olsen, Perinoff, Pernick. (10)
NAYS: Rowland, Skarritt, Wilcox, Caddell, Calandro, Fortino,
Hobart, R. Kuhn, S. Kuhn, Law, McConnell, McDonald, McPherson, Nelson,
Page, Price, Rewold. (17)
A sufficient majority not having voted therefor, the amendment
failed.
Vote on resolution:
AYE: Skarritt, Webb, Wilcox, Aaron, Caddell, Calandro, Doyon,
Fortino, Gosling, Hobart, R. Kuhn, S. Kuhn, Lanni, Law, McConnell,
McDonald, McPherson, Moffitt, Nelson, Page, Perinoff, Pernick, Price,
Rewold, Rowland. (25)
NAYS: Hassberger, Olsen. (2)
A sufficient majority having voted therefor, the resolution was
adopted.
